117.info
人生若只如初见

linux启动oracle数据库报错怎么解决

要解决Linux启动Oracle数据库报错的问题,您可以尝试以下几种方法:

  1. 检查Oracle数据库的日志文件,查看具体的错误信息。通常Oracle数据库的日志文件位于$ORACLE_BASE/diag/rdbms///trace目录下,您可以查看alert_.log文件来了解详细的错误信息。

  2. 确保Oracle数据库的相关环境变量设置正确,包括ORACLE_HOME、ORACLE_SID等环境变量的设置。您可以通过echo $ORACLE_HOME和echo $ORACLE_SID来检查这些环境变量的值是否正确。

  3. 检查Oracle数据库实例的状态,您可以使用SQL*Plus或者lsnrctl命令连接到数据库实例,然后执行select status from v$instance;来查看数据库实例的状态是否正常。

  4. 检查Oracle数据库的监听器是否正常运行,您可以使用lsnrctl status命令来查看监听器的状态。

  5. 检查Linux系统的资源是否足够,包括内存、磁盘空间等资源是否充足。

如果以上方法无法解决问题,建议您尝试重启Oracle数据库或者重启Linux系统,有时候这样可以解决一些启动问题。如果问题仍然存在,建议您查阅Oracle官方文档或者向Oracle技术支持寻求帮助。

未经允许不得转载 » 本文链接:https://www.117.info/ask/febf1AzsICABTB1c.html

推荐文章

  • linux打开终端oracle不响应怎么解决

    如果在Linux终端中打开Oracle时遇到无响应的情况,你可以尝试以下解决方法: 查看日志:在终端中输入以下命令,查看是否有任何错误或异常信息。 tail -f $ORACLE...

  • linux怎么查看oracle服务状态

    在Linux中,可以使用以下命令来查看Oracle服务的状态: 使用lsnrctl status命令来查看监听器的状态: lsnrctl status 使用ps -ef | grep pmon命令来查看Oracle实...

  • linux如何查看oracle字符集编码

    在Linux上,可以通过以下步骤查看Oracle的字符集编码: 首先,登录到Oracle数据库的命令行界面。 执行以下命令来查看Oracle数据库的字符集编码: SELECT * FROM ...

  • linux怎么结束oracle进程

    要结束Oracle进程,可以按照以下步骤进行: 确认你具有管理员权限(root用户或具有sudo权限的用户)。 打开终端窗口。 使用以下命令查找正在运行的Oracle进程: ...

  • ubuntu中怎么搭建个人网站

    要在Ubuntu上搭建个人网站,您可以使用Apache、Nginx或其他web服务器软件,并安装PHP、MySQL等相关的软件。以下是一些基本步骤来搭建个人网站: 安装Apache或Ngi...

  • python怎么用类访问json属性

    在Python中,你可以使用类来访问JSON属性。首先,你需要将JSON数据加载到Python的字典对象中,然后可以使用该字典对象作为类的属性。以下是一个示例代码:
    ...

  • java中before和after的区别是什么

    在Java中,@Before和@After是JUnit测试框架的注解,用于在测试方法执行之前和之后执行指定的代码。
    @Before注解表示在每个测试方法执行之前都会执行注解标记...

  • centos7创建用户组的方法是什么

    要在CentOS 7上创建用户组,您可以使用以下命令:
    sudo groupadd [group_name] 这将在系统中创建一个名为[group_name]的新用户组。您可以使用以下命令查看新...